SinglePipe and IBBS Announce Integrated Back-end Support for Cable Operators Deploying Digital Voice
—Partnership Matches Industry’s Leading Wholesale Voice Managed Service Offering With Award-Winning OSS Software and Support—
Washington, DC – SinglePipe Communications (SinglePipe), a leading managed service provider of wholesale digital voice solutions, and Integrated Broadband Services, LLC (IBBS), a leading provider of OSS software and services for broadband and tier 2 cable operators, today introduced a joint, integrated back office solution for voice, video and data to cable customers.
This offering will combine Broadband Explorer, IBBS’ award-winning diagnostics and provisioning software, with the SinglePipe Integrated Provisioning System Platform (SIPS) for Digital Voice.
